Review Of Lasik Eye Surgical Procedure
Lasik eye surgical procedure is like a set of glasses for the eyes; it changes view to assist people see even more plainly. It's an operation that improves the cornea, enabling light to go into the eye and also be concentrated correctly on the retina. This implies that as opposed to needing corrective lenses, individuals can have perfect vision without them.
The procedure is fairly quick and also pain-free; it generally takes around 10 mins per eye with very little pain. In https://www.africanews.com/2018/05/19/tanzania-lasik-surgery-introduced-in-dar-es-salaam/ , although there are some threats related to the surgical procedure, most individuals that obtain Lasik record extremely little or no negative effects. If you have astigmatism or presbyopia, you may still have the ability to get Lasik surgical procedure relying on your private circumstance. Your physician will have the ability to advise the very best strategy based upon your medical history and existing condition.

Dealing With Presbyopia With Lasik
When it involves Lasik eye surgical procedure and treating presbyopia, the procedure is a little various compared to that of astigmatism. please click the following webpage is a problem that commonly impacts those over 40 years of ages, and also it creates trouble with close to vision because of a weakening of the eye's concentrating muscle mass. Lasik surgery for presbyopia entails producing two separate laser treatments - one for distance vision and one for near vision. This can give individuals with improved view in both far and near distances.
The recuperation process from Lasik surgical treatment for presbyopia is similar to that of normal Lasik treatments, indicating individuals ought to expect some dry skin and also irritation in their eyes, as well as obscured vision as they recover. It's important to keep in mind that since this kind of Lasik surgical treatment does entail 2 different therapies, patients might require to wait up to three months before totally experiencing the advantages. Nevertheless, once recovered, most people that have undergone the treatment record boosted vision at both far and near distances.
